제품군의 상세 설명

TECHSPEC® N-BK7 Wedged Windows는 30 arcminute wedge의 표준 미터법(metric) 크기로 제공됩니다. 이 윈도우의 웨지(wedge)는 후면에서 일어나는 반사가 투과빔과 동일한 광경로를 따라 이동하는 것을 방지하는 방식으로 에탈론 효과를 제거합니다. 레이저 공진기에서의 wedged window는 불필요한 반사로 인해 야기되는 레이저의 불안정성, 모드 변화, 전력 급등을 방지하는 데 도움이 됩니다. TECHSPEC N-BK7 Wedged Windows는 Fused Silica Wedged Windows를 대체할 수 있는 비용 효율적인 제품으로서 UV 투과를 요구하지 않는 용도나 고출력 VIS 또는 NIR 레이저에서와 같이 높은 수준의 열 안정성을 필요로 하지 않는 용도에 사용됩니다. 이 밖에도 wedged window는 빔 샘플러나 빔 픽오프 광학 부품처럼 사용되어 시간 경과에 따른 빔의 강도와 같이 레이저 빔의 특성을 모니터링할 때 사용할 수 있습니다.
